Imagine a classroom where every student has a personal mentor, guiding them through the often-challenging process of creative problem-solving. That's the promise of Mentigo, an AI-powered system designed to nurture young minds and empower them to tackle real-world problems with innovative solutions. Developed by researchers, Mentigo acts as a virtual guide, leading middle school students through the stages of creative problem-solving (CPS). Unlike simple AI tools that just provide answers, Mentigo fosters deeper learning by offering structured guidance, personalized feedback, and even emotional support. Based on a wealth of real classroom interactions between students and human mentors, Mentigo understands the nuances of learning and adapts its approach to each student’s needs. It helps students define problems, brainstorm ideas, evaluate solutions, and ultimately, develop their creative thinking skills. In a user study comparing Mentigo to a basic AI system, students using Mentigo spent significantly more time engaged with tasks and produced more comprehensive and innovative solutions. They praised its structured approach, personalized feedback, and supportive, almost human-like interaction style. Experts who reviewed the study results echoed these findings, noting that Mentigo encouraged deeper cognitive engagement and fostered more creativity than the baseline system. While further research is needed to fully understand its potential, Mentigo represents a promising step towards a future where AI mentors can unlock creativity and empower students to become innovative problem-solvers. Future research will focus on implementing Mentigo in real classrooms and exploring its use in collaborative learning settings, potentially transforming how we approach education and nurture creativity in young minds.

How does Mentigo's AI system structure its creative problem-solving guidance for students?
Mentigo employs a multi-stage approach based on analyzed classroom interactions between students and human mentors. The system guides students through defined phases: problem definition, idea generation, solution evaluation, and creative thinking development. It processes real mentor-student interaction data to provide contextually appropriate guidance and adapts its responses based on individual student needs and progress. For example, when a student is struggling with problem definition, Mentigo might offer prompting questions and scaffolded support similar to how a human mentor would guide the conversation, helping the student break down complex problems into manageable components.
